sozercanie_kosmosa
@sozercanie_kosmosa

Как вызвать метод через ссылку на него в переменной?

1. Почему не получается использовать метод через переменную?

2. Как правильно сформировать ссылку на метод в переменной, что бы потом его можно было вызвать через эту переменную?

canvas = document.createElement('canvas');
document.body.appendChild(canvas);

var gl = canvas.getContext('webgl');

var mtd = gl.clearColor;
mtd(1, 0, 0, 1); // вот тут ругается!

upd: ошибся чуть-чуть, прошу прощения
  • Вопрос задан
  • 118 просмотров
Пригласить эксперта
Ответы на вопрос 1
NeiroNext
@NeiroNext
Ну так вы приравниваете функцию переменной mdt, так и вызывайте тогда mtd(), либо прировняйте mtd = gl и вызовите уже так как вызываете, но смысл в двух переменных
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ы